Gingivitis or not healthy gums can cause:

  • Inflamed gums
  • Tenderness
  • Redness and swollen gums
  • Prone to bleeding

Floss well for healthy gums

As we have already established, most people are not brushing their teeth daily because they simply cannot fit it into their busy life. How frequently you floss your teeth has a huge impact on your dental health. Flossing is a reflexive habit that is easy to put into practice. You should be flossing your teeth at least once a day, but ideally twice. Most people can fit flossing into their daily life because they do it while they are watching television or while they’re waiting for the kettle to boil.

One of the best ways to keep your gums healthy is to floss your teeth. If you do this at least once a day, you will be preventing diseases like gingivitis. When you are flossing your teeth, you are scraping away bacteria from the gums that can cause gum disease.
